Steven R. Beckert
Frankenmuth, MI
Entered into eternal rest on Tuesday, May 6, 2025 at University of Michigan Hospital, Ann Arbor; age 82 years. Steven was born on March 25, 1943 in Owosso, MI to the late LeRoy and Leona Beckert. He married Susan Finch on October 3, 1964; she survives him. Steve graduated from the University of Michigan with his master's degree in engineering. He worked for General Motors and EDS until his retirement in 1999. He was a member of Trinity Episcopal Church, Bay City. Steve enjoyed playing bridge and cribbage at the church, he also served as Treasurer. He also enjoyed logic puzzles, fly fishing, golfing and watching professional golf, and watching all U of M sports. Most of all he loved spending time with his family, and playing board games together.
Surviving besides his wife Susan are their 2 children Michael (Leslie Joerke) Beckert of Brighton, MI and Jennifer (Kiyoshi) Urabe of Ann Arbor, MI; grandchildren Madelyn (Zachary) Lang of Milford CT, Andrew Urabe currently residing in Tokyo, Japan; 2 sisters Kathryn "Trink" (John) Hollett of Jacksonville, FL and Barbara White of Owosso, MI, and nieces and nephews.
